55int
56bfs_init(struct bfs **bfsp)
57{
58	int err, bfs_sector;
59
60	device_attach(2, 0, -1);	/* HARDDISK UNIT 0 */
61
62	if ((err = bfs_find(&bfs_sector)) != 0)
63		return err;
64
65	return bfs_init2(bfsp, bfs_sector, &__io_ops, false);
66}
67
68int
69bfs_find(int *sector)
70{
71	static uint8_t buf[DEV_BSIZE];
72	struct pdinfo_sector *pdinfo;
73	struct vtoc_sector *vtoc;
74	const struct ux_partition *bfs_partition;
75	int start;
76
77	/* Physical Disk INFOrmation */
78	pdinfo = (struct pdinfo_sector *)buf;
79	if (!pdinfo_sector(0, pdinfo) || !pdinfo_sanity(pdinfo))
80		return ENOENT;
81
82	/* `start' is logical sector start in UX partition table. */
83	start = pdinfo->logical_sector;
84
85	/* Volume Table Of Contents */
86	vtoc = (struct vtoc_sector *)buf;
87	if (!vtoc_sector(0, vtoc, start))
88		return ENOENT;
89
90	/* Boot File System partition */
91	if ((bfs_partition = vtoc_find_bfs(vtoc)) == 0)
92		return ENOENT;
93
94	*sector = start + bfs_partition->start_sector;
95
96	return 0;
97}
